Hi everybody!

I've been suffering through some hard-drive failures at home, but working through other stuff on the side of fixing them seemed a good idea.

As I need the code for my JSON plugins, I have updated Evan Balster's super-excellent Modloader Plugin, and all of the associated TiddlyWikiFormulas plugins, to be compatible with the current pre-release of 5.1.20.

I hope you all can find some good use for this!

(Oh yeah I fixed some bugs when using the "mushroom syntax" as a value for element properties, so all of the example work in Chrome ... let me know if you see weirdness.)

The code is on my guthub account, but my (temporary) example wiki is here:

https://joshuafontany.github.io/TiddlyWikiFormula/

Grab all the plugins you want/need from there. All of Evan's examples and tests are included.

I have sent a pull request, but we haven't seen Evan around for a while, so I'm going to be upkeeping this atm.

Correct, these plugins will not work with 5.1.19. No syntax changes, so if you fire up a 5.1.20 wiki or node/bob instance and drag another wiki that has older plugin versions, those will not be imported - only your tiddlers with formulas, etc.
